Output 8305330bff94db5000795289450d9b8be2068ed224d106e7b107d88e1477c2a6:6

value
878607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85306d0a232e9caea42074e54c807c0deea1a07f OP_EQUAL
address
3DqFokTygmezdmtP4uULzHqpizSJRA5ZHr
transaction
8305330bff94db5000795289450d9b8be2068ed224d106e7b107d88e1477c2a6
spent
true